Job description

Overview

Lead the Future of Sustainable Infrastructure

Step into a leadership role where transportation strategy meets global impact. At ERM, as a Principal Consultant, Planning Engineer / Transportation, based in Washington, DC (hybrid), you’ll help shape the trajectory of major capital projects that enable the energy transition and sustainable infrastructure worldwide. This is a strategic, high-visibility opportunity to influence how complex projects are planned, approved, and delivered—while mentoring others and growing a best-in-class transportation practice.

Why This Role Matters

Transportation planning sits at the core of every successful infrastructure project. In this role, you’ll provide strategic direction and technical leadership across a diverse portfolio—from electric transmission and renewable energy (wind, solar, hydropower, battery storage) to large-scale extractive projects. Your expertise will ensure projects are compliant, efficient, and aligned with both U.S. regulatory standards and global sustainability benchmarks—directly advancing ERM’s mission to deliver innovative, responsible solutions.

What Your Impact Is

  • Lead transportation analyses for U.S.-based projects, ensuring alignment with state DOT requirements and global best practices.
  • Deliver IFC-compliant Environmental and Social Impact Assessments (ESIA) for international initiatives.
  • Shape project outcomes by defining methodologies, contributing to proposals, and guiding technical strategy.
  • Expand ERM’s transportation planning capabilities through business development, client engagement, and thought leadership.
  • Mentor and develop emerging talent, strengthening team capability and impact.

Required

What You'll Bring

  •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ering, Transportation Engineering, Urban/Transportation Planning, or related field or equivalent experience.
  • 6+ years (10+ years preferred) of progressive experience in transportation planning/engineering for major capital projects.
  • Strong expertise in U.S. transportation standards and frameworks (NEPA, FHWA/FTA guidance, HCM, MUTCD) and state/local requirements.
  •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to translate complex technical concepts into clear insights for clients and stakeholders.
  • Authorization to work in the U.S.

Preferred

  • Master’s degree in Transportation Engineering/Planning or related field
  • Professional licensure or certification (PE, PTOE, AICP, RSP, or equivalent).
  • Proficiency in transportation and traffic modeling tools (Synchro/SimTraffic, HCS, VISSIM/SIDRA, GIS, travel demand modeling).
  • Experience supporting international projects and working within IFI-funded frameworks.
  • Demonstrated success in business development and industry thought leadership.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ead multimodal transportation impact assessments (road, rail, vessel, air) for both construction and operational phases of major projects.
  • Develop and apply methodologies aligned with NEPA, FHWA/FTA guidance, state/local regulations, and international standards.
  • Contribute to proposal development by defining scope, methodology, and level of effort for transportation components.
  • Build and strengthen client relationships while leading pursuits for new transportation planning opportunities.
  • Mentor junior team members and foster an inclusive, collaborative, and high-performing team culture.
  • Occasional travel for client meetings and field reviews across project locations.
